Ronel Blanco (30, Houston Astros), the protagonist of the first no-hitter (no-hit, no-run) in the 2024 American Professional Baseball Major League (MLB), was suspended for 10 games for ‘use of foreign substances’. .

The MLB Secretariat announced on the 16th (Korean time), “Blanco will be suspended for 10 games and will be fined. The amount of the fine will not be disclosed.”

The Athletic reported, “Blanco said he would appeal the suspension before the MLB Secretariat makes a decision.”

Blanco started the home game against the Oakland Athletics held at Minute Maid Park in Houston, Texas, USA on the 15th and pitched 3 innings without allowing any runs while allowing only 4 hits.

However, just before he pitched in the top of the 4th inning, he was ordered to leave after being found to have used a foreign substance during the umpire’s glove inspection.

After closely examining Blanco’s fingers and glove, the referee determined that he had smeared a foreign substance on the ball and sent him off.

Referee Erich Backus said, “When I looked at Blanco’s glove in the first inning, there was no problem. But in the fourth inning, I found a very sticky substance inside Blanco’s glove. I have never felt this much stickiness since I started refereeing. “There is none,” he said.

Blanco and Houston coach Joe Espada claimed, “While touching the rosin bag, the rosin powder entered the glove and mixed with sweat.”

However, the referee defined it as a ‘foreign substance’ and ordered him to leave, and the MLB Secretariat also issued a suspension.

The more damaged the baseball is, the better it is for the pitcher. This is because more changes occur in the pitcher’s ball flying toward the batter.

This is also the reason why applying foreign substances to the ball is prohibited in all leagues.

In particular, the MLB Secretariat has instructed umpires to actively inspect pitchers for use of foreign substances during games starting in June 2021.

On April 2 of this year, Blanco pitched his first no-hitter of the season by pitching 2 walks, 7 strikeouts, and no runs in 9 innings against the Toronto Blue Jays without giving up a single hit.

He continued his momentum and pitched well this season with 4 wins, no losses, and an ERA of 2.09.
